Haiti - Insalubrity : 9 mayors of the metropolitan area call the authorities to dialogue
Considering, among other things, that for decades the Haitian State has failed to provide urban and rural communities with decent sanitary conditions despite the creation in 1983 of the Metropolitan Solid Waste Collection Service (SMCRS), setting out the responsibilities of the various instances (Town Halls: sweeping and SMCRS: pickup) for the protection of the environment. That the fatras constitute a scourge and a health hazard that puts the mayors in an extremely delicate situation vis-à-vis the inhabitants of their respective commune, which despite the legal responsibilities of the SMCRS as for the collection of garbage, put mainly in question the responsibility mayors...

Tuesday, January 9, in a joint declaration 9 mayors of the Metropolitan Region : Jude Edouard (Carrefour), Jean Hislain Fréderic (Cité Soleil), Rony Colin (Croix-des-Bouquets), Wilson Jeudy (Delmas), Dieulie Augustin (Gressier), Eunide Amilcar (Kenscoff), Dominique St Roc (Pétion-ville), Youri Chevry (Port-au-Prince) and Bastien Jean Voltaire, Deslien Philippe (deputy mayors of Tabarre), affirm that the fight against fatras is their first priority and they are ready to discuss with the government, all relevant state authorities and the private sector to define and implement innovative solutions to solve in a sustainable way the problem of unsanitary conditions in the metropolitan area of Port-au-Prince.
